    Common Challenges in Bank Statement Conversion for BMO

    Financial professionals often face significant hurdles when converting BMO bank statements from PDF or paper formats into actionable data files. Here are the most common pain points:

    1. Inconsistent PDF Formats and Layouts

    BMO statements vary by account type and date, complicating automated parsing. Traditional PDF to CSV converters struggle with inconsistent column headers, multi-page statements, and embedded images.

    2. Manual Data Entry Errors

    Relying on manual transcription leads to costly mistakes. A 2022 report by the Association of Accountants found that manual entry errors cause a 15% increase in reconciliation time.

    3. Lack of Integration with Accounting Software

    Many solutions fail to produce files compatible with QuickBooks, Xero, or ERP systems, forcing extra steps like reformatting or manual imports.

    4. Security and Compliance Concerns

    Handling sensitive financial data requires adherence to GDPR, SOX, and PCI-DSS standards. Insecure conversion tools risk data breaches and regulatory penalties.

    5. Time-Consuming Batch Processing

    Processing multiple BMO statements individually is inefficient. Without batch conversion capabilities, finance teams waste valuable hours.

    Step-by-Step Implementation

    Ready to automate your BMO bank statement conversion? Follow this proven roadmap:

    Step 1: Assess Your Current Workflow

    Identify pain points such as manual entry bottlenecks, error rates, and software compatibility issues.

    Step 2: Choose the Right Conversion Tool

    Evaluate options based on supported formats, OCR accuracy, batch processing, security features, and pricing. Consider platforms like bank statement converter that specialize in BMO statement processing.

    Step 3: Prepare Your Documents

    Gather BMO PDF statements, ensuring they are legible and complete. For scanned images, verify resolution exceeds 300 DPI for optimal OCR results.

    Step 4: Configure Parsing Rules

    Customize extraction templates to match BMO statement layouts, specifying fields like transaction date, description, amount, and balance.

    Step 5: Batch Upload and Convert

    Use the platform’s batch upload feature to process multiple statements simultaneously. Monitor progress and review extracted data for accuracy.

    Step 6: Export to Desired Format

    Select output formats such as CSV for spreadsheet analysis, Excel for detailed reporting, or QBO/OFX for direct import into accounting software. For example, learn how to convert PDF to CSV or PDF to Excel conversion seamlessly.

    Step 7: Integrate with Accounting Systems

    Import converted files into QuickBooks, Xero, or ERP platforms. Use specialized converters like CSV to QBO converter or CSV to MT940 converter to ensure compatibility.

    Step 8: Review and Reconcile

    Validate data integrity and reconcile accounts promptly to catch discrepancies early.

    FAQs

    Q1: What is the best way to convert PDF bank statements from BMO to Excel? A: Use a specialized PDF to Excel converter with OCR capabilities that supports BMO layouts. This ensures accurate extraction of transaction data into spreadsheet columns.

    Q2: Can I batch convert multiple BMO statements at once? A: Yes, modern platforms offer batch processing features allowing you to upload and convert hundreds of statements simultaneously, saving time.

    Q3: How secure is automated bank statement conversion? A: Leading tools use encryption, secure cloud storage, and compliance certifications (GDPR, SOX) to protect sensitive financial data.

    Q4: Is it possible to convert BMO statements directly to QuickBooks format? A: Absolutely. Many converters support PDF to QBO conversion, enabling seamless import into QuickBooks.

    Q5: What formats are supported besides CSV and Excel? A: Common formats include OFX, MT940, CAMT.053, and BAI2, which are widely used for ERP and treasury workflows.

    Q6: How do I handle scanned BMO statements? A: Ensure scans are high resolution (300 DPI+). Use OCR-enabled converters that can extract data from images effectively.

    Q7: Are there free tools for BMO statement conversion? A: Free tools exist but often lack batch processing, accuracy, and security features essential for professional use.
